Update on the Morgan Stanley and Feeding America Partnership
In 2014, Morgan Stanley launched Healthy Cities, a philanthropic program designed to fuel innovation in coordinating the wellness, nutrition and play resources that can underpin a child’s healthy start in life. Collaborating with national and local nonprofit organizations, including Feeding America and select network member food banks, Healthy Cities helps connect otherwise separate programs and creates a linked package of wellness education and screenings, nutritious foods and safe play spaces for children in neighborhoods in need.
